Artist Statement
Jessica Ahrens has explored themes of emptiness, loneliness and darkness in her work as a contemporary artist from an early age. Drawing inspiration from decay in the natural world, things that were and are no longer, Jessica uses her camera to beautify the twisting scarred fingers of dead tree limbs, dusty wings of moths, reflections and intersections in darkened waters and intricate layers of bones. She uses in-camera multiple exposures and the use of glass and mirrors, to create both defined geometric images as well as more chaotic and haphazard ones, attempting to create worlds and impressions more interesting than reality.
